Aoineadh a' Bhaile-dhoire

cliff or slope · Argyll and Bute

GaelicAI-generated

This name refers to a slope or cliff near a wooded settlement. 'Aoineadh' means slope or cliff, and 'a' Bhaile-dhoire' means of the wooded town/settlement.

Word origins

Aoineadh
Gaelicslope, cliff(from aonach "hill, ridge")
a' Bhaile-dhoire
Gaelicof the wooded town/settlement(from baile "town, settlement", doire "wood, grove")
